The rules of professional product development are being rewritten in real time. - PMs and designers can ship software as easily as engineers. - Software is no longer just built for humans—it’s also built for agents as first-class citizens. To better understand how we build products in this world, I invited Mike Krieger (Mike Krieger) on Every 📧’s AI & I podcast. Mike cofounded Instagram and is now a member of the technical staff at Anthropic, co-leading Anthropic Labs, their internal incubator for experimental products. He's been at the frontier of two transformative technology waves: mobile/social and now agent-native software. We discussed: - How to build a truly agent-native product. The best products today, like Claude Code, allow users to do things that their creators never intended. But that requires hard trade-offs between freedom and safety/reliability for frontier products, an issue that Mike's team is learning how to solve. - What's different about building now versus building Instagram. At Instagram, it took months to hit dead ends and learn what to cut. Now, that cycle runs in hours. - The trap of building too much, too fast with agents. You can go from idea to a nearly-shipped product in a day, but that process doesn’t give you the incremental feedback that used to tell you what not to build. The models are great at adding features, but can create a product that lacks coherence. - How Anthropic Labs structures product teams. New product experiments are led by only two people, usually a product manager or designer paired with an engineer. Mike says bigger teams tend to be too slow because of coordination costs. - Why you need to throw out your product and start over every three to six months. AI progress means most of your harness will be outdated quickly—the best teams build this into their product strategy. And much more! You should watch this one. They went viral not because they're complicated but because they're simple building blocks, and once you see them you can prompt your way to building real systems. 🎬YouTube: Here's the whole thing in one picture. An LLM is a powerful brain that knows everything about humanity and nothing about you or the software you're running. The harness is the set of tools you put on that horse so it runs where you want. Memory gives it context: who you are, what happened before, how to act. The loop lets it call tools again and again, with guardrails so it knows when to stop. Eval and LLM Ops trace every run, score it, and feed the fixes back in so the system keeps improving itself. Master these four and you can read almost any AI agent repo or paper and actually know what's going on. You Can Build Anything. Agents join sessions within a Space - a domain like finance, writing, or games. Each session runs as a series of competitive rounds. In every round, agents try to generate the best solution to a task. Their outputs are scored by a decentralized network of AI judges trained to evaluate quality for that domain. The top agents in each round earn rewards from the pooled entry fees. The losers get to learn. Feedback from each round helps them adjust and improve, and every session becomes a training loop.
